
Любой начинающий веб-разработчик задается вопросом о том, с чего стоит начать изготовление своего сайта? Надо понимать, что быстро создать сайт не получится, так как разработка сайтов включает в себя много этапов, и от каждого этапа зависит успех вашего проекта. Следовательно, надо составить план разработки и задуматься над реализацией каждого пункта.
Если вы не хотите заморачиваться всем тем о чем пойдет речь в этой статье, рекомендую заказать изготовление сайта по этому адресу.
Разработку сайта можно разделить на 4 самых главных этапа:
- Создание идеи сайта
- Создание макета сайта
- Программирование страниц сайта
- Посадка сайта на движок
Теперь остановимся на каждом из этапов подробнее.
Содержание статьи
Создание идеи сайта
Во-первых, подумайте о чём будет ваш сайт. Это может быть новостной блог, интернет магазин, сайт организации и т.д. После стоит обдумать каждую деталь сайта. Какие записи на нём будут, и как он будет примерно выглядеть в дальнейшем. Только после того, когда с тематикой сайта было покончено, можно переходить к следующему этапу разработки.
Создание макета сайта
На этом этапе нужно разработать дизайн каждой страницы вашего сайта. Здесь есть две детали, которые нужно учесть.
- Во-первых, какой графический редактор нужно использовать. Например, это может быть Adobe Photoshop.
- Во-вторых, нужно обладать некоторыми знаниями по компоновке и разбираться в сочетании цветов.
Можно сказать, что от дизайна будет зависеть 80% успеха сайта, так как первым делом пользователь видит дизайн сайта, и его не интересует то, как работает ваш сайт. Если вы не уверены в своих дизайнерских навыках, то вам стоит найти специалиста, который сделает эту работу.
Программирование страниц сайта
После того, как каркас сайта был готов, пора заглянуть под капот и превратить макет в рабочий сайт. Этот этап обычно делиться на два.
- Во-первых, это вёрстка сайта. Здесь нужно обладать хотя бы базовыми знаниями CSS, HTML и JavaScript. Верстальщики работают с готовыми макетами и редакторами кода. На просторах интернета можно найти много статей и видео уроков по вёрстке сайтом. Если говорить более точно, то верстка — это создание точной копии макета со всеми анимациями и таблицами и прочем на языке понятному браузеру.
- Вторым шагом на данном этапе будет программирование функционала сайта. Для этого потребуются знания в языках программирования PHP или Python. Какой язык выбрать решает сам разработчик. При помощи скриптов оживает сайт. Теперь это уже не просто статическая страница, а сайт способный хранить базы данных клиентов, осуществлять работу с деньгами и много чего другого.Всё зависит от того, что вам нужно.
Посадка сайта на движок
Движок позволяет удобно осуществлять управление сайтом, добавлять в него новые товары или статьи, а также добавлять новые страницы. Посадить сайт на движок не трудно. В интернете можно найти множество видео уроков, где опытные программисты расскажут, какие манипуляции потребуется совершить с файлами сайта, чтобы он нормально работал на том или ином движке. Остаётся только выбрать движок, который подойдет для вашего сайта. Вот список самых популярных движков: WordPress, Joomla, Drupal, Magento, PrestaShop, Typo3.